AngularJS Modules

Modules are used to seperate logics and keep the code clean. So we can define modules in separate js file. Here we will create two modules i.e. Controller Module and Application Module. AngularJS Controller

To control the flow of data AngularJS mainly relies on controllers. It is defined using ng-controller directive. Controller contain attributes, properties and functions.
